Congressman Krishnamoorthi Responds To Attorney General Barr’s Summary Of Mueller Report

March 24, 2019

SCHAUMBURG, IL – Congressman Raja Krishnamoorthi issued the following statement in response to Attorney General Barr's summary of the Mueller Report's conclusions:

"The letter from Attorney General Barr reveals his own interpretations of Special Counsel Mueller's conclusions, introduces a range of unanswered questions, and reaffirms the need for maximum transparency that can only be achieved by releasing the Special Counsel's full report and the underlying documents supporting it. The American taxpayers paid for the Mueller Report and should be able to see what they paid for. Congress and the American people cannot rely on the Attorney General's interpretations and conclusions alone.

According to Attorney General Barr's summary, the Special Counsel's investigation did not exonerate the President. It is imperative that Congress have the opportunity to examine these findings in full while continuing our broader investigations and informing the American people as to what happened in 2016 and how Russian interference, and interference by any foreign power, can be prevented in the future."
